All About CAN ACT
|
CAN ACT,
Caldwell and Nampa Alliance of Community Theatre, was started in 1991, when three
actors, Toni
Mendoza, Nancy Richards, and Marilyn Gunderson, decided to put the group
together to provide an outlet for talented people in the area that didn't involve a drive to Boise.
|
The First CAN ACT production was the Agatha Christy murder mystery
The Mouse Trap and was performed at
Vallievue High School. After that,
CAN ACT began
doing dinner theatre at The Dutch Inn in Nampa. The first production there
was LETS
MURDER
MARSHA , written by Monk Ferris.

In 1996, after
four seasons of dinner theatre, the groups desire to expand lead them to Karcher Mall . Where they opened
their season
with DRACULA, THE MUSICAL, written by Ted Tiller. The Karcher location has
served CAN ACT and theatre goings very well. For the first time the group
was able to
store props and rehearse at one place. No more midnight trips in the dark
to cold storage units or lugging flats and risers from show to show. Thank you God, and Karcher Mall!
